A 2-year-old dwarf rabbit was referred for right forelimb lameness of 1-week duration. Physical examination and radiographic findings were consistent with an elbow luxation. Manual reduction under anesthesia was unsuccessful in correcting the luxated joint. A surgical approach was recommended to repair the rabbit elbow luxation. Transcondylar, transradial, and transulnar tunnels were drilled from lateral to medial with 2 suture prostheses being placed, 1 from the radius to the humerus and 1 from the humerus to the ulna. Analgesia was provided and the patient was reevaluated on days 2, 7, and 14 after the procedure. The luxation was reduced and no recurrence was noted a year following the surgical procedure. Circumferential suture prostheses, recently described with no reported postoperative complications in cats, can be used successfully in rabbits as evidenced in this case report. 相似文献

The properties and cutting performance of partial sintered Y2O3-stabilized tetragonal zirconia polycrystal (Y-TZP) have been introduced. Then, the CAD/CAM technological chain in the field of dental restoration, the basic grinding theory and technical equipment which are necessary for dental restoration have also been analyzed. Finally, an example for grinding molar crown using partial sintered zirconia has been provided, the specific processing are divided into two steps:1)using standard cylindrical dental diamond burs which is Ф1.6 mm to fabricate the molar crown with grinding parameters(spindle speed 40 000 r/min, grinding depth 0.2 mm, feed rate 300 mm/min)that have high material removal rate;2)using dental diamond burs with ball-end cone wheel, whose diameter is 0.8 mm, with spindle speed 40 000 r/min, grinding depth 0.06 mm, feed rate 100 mm/min, to fine grinding the surface of molar crown. After processing, the surface quality of the molar crown has been tested high and is consistent with the requirements of dental restoration. 相似文献
